Base de Données

Base de données relationnelle

Le modèle de bases de données relationnelles

Les systèmes de base de données relationnelle (SGBDR) vous permettent de stocker des données dans des tables informatiques. Ils sont associés à des concepts complexes tels que les formes normales. Nous présentons les bases du système de base de données relationnelle, étudions ses avantages et inconvénients et comparons avec les approches alternatives telles que les bases de données orientées...

Créer une sauvegarde de serveur avec rsync

Sauvegarde de serveur avec rsync

Une sauvegarde de serveur est le meilleur moyen pour sécuriser les fichiers importants de votre projet Web et prévenir toute perte de données. Il est judicieux de procéder à des sauvegardes dans les environnements de serveurs en prenant compte de tous les périphériques. Pour cela, des programmes performants sont nécessaires. Au-delà des solutions physiques ou en ligne qui sont coûteuses, il existe...

Le Big Data, c’est quoi ?

Big data : définition et exemples

Sur Internet, nous faisons nos courses, nous réservons nos séjours de vacances, nous recherchons des idées de cadeaux… Sans toujours nous préoccuper des traces laissées par nos recherches. Les sites avides de données collectent ces informations pour créer ce que l’on nomme le Big Data : des ensembles de fichiers qui sont analysés et utilisés à des fins diverses. Doit-on néanmoins craindre ce...

IndexedDB

IndexedDB : tutoriel pour la mémoire dans le navigateur

Tenir à disposition des données dans le client contribue à rendre Internet plus rapide et plus flexible, et à offrir aux utilisateurs une meilleure expérience de navigation. IndexedDB permet d’enregistrer de gros volumes de données dans les navigateurs des utilisateurs afin de ne pas avoir à les charger à nouveau à chaque consultation du site Internet. Découvrez IndexedDB à travers un exemple.

CRUD : les opérations de base de données les plus importantes

CRUD : La base de la gestion de données.

Ceux qui travaillent au développement de logiciels, connaissant bien le concept de CRUD. Cet acronyme englobe les opérations classiques pour la communication avec les systèmes de base de données qui constituent par défaut la base de la gestion des données. Mais comment peut-on configurer exactement ces fonctions d’accès à la gestion des données ? Et quel rôle jouent les langues de programmation et...

Sauvegarde des bases de données

Sauvegarde de bases de données

Créer des sauvegardes permet de protéger les bases de données. Ce processus nécessite du matériel informatique supplémentaire et la mise en place d’un support de stockage. Comment est-il possible de sécuriser son propre réseau, c.-à-d. son serveur Web contre les attaques extérieures, et ainsi protéger ses bases de données ?

MariaDB vs MySQL

MariaDB vs. MySQL

MySQL est l’un des systèmes de gestion de bases de données les plus utilisés au monde. Le logiciel est considéré par de nombreux utilisateurs comme la solution standard pour les bases de données relationnelles. Mais cela pourrait bientôt changer. Le fork MariaDB de MySQL rattrape son retard et constitue une alternative de plus en plus séduisante à la base de données classique. Comparaison des...

Data mining : la méthode d’analyse du Big Data

Data mining : comment exploiter au mieux le potentiel des données

Chaque année, la quantité de données circulant mondialement sur le Web augmente de 40 pourcent. Les entreprises veulent mettre à contribution cette croissance constante pour étendre les possibilités ainsi offertes au commerce en ligne. Mais le Big Data à lui seul ne peut pas permettre l’acquisition de connaissances. Pour cela, il convient de se plier à l’analyse des données, à l’aide de méthodes...

diagramme d’activité

Diagrammes d’activité : une présentation claire des séquences chronologiques d’activités avec UML

Les diagrammes d’activité UML vous permettent d’afficher sous forme de graphique la séquence chronologique des processus système dans la programmation orientée objet. Les diagrammes d’activité montrent quelles actions ont lieu dans quel ordre pour exécuter une activité. Avec un diagramme terminé, vous pouvez créer des blocs de codes à l’aide du transfert XML. Souhaitez-vous cartographier les...

MongoDB : présentation et comparaison avec MySQL

MongoDB : présentation et comparaison avec MySQL

Les bases de données NoSQL sont devenues depuis longtemps une alternative populaire aux bases de données relationnelles classiques comme MySQL. La structure de mémorisation non flexible des modèles traditionnels y est adaptable et permet leur sécurisation. Ainsi, la base de données peut par exemple être distribuée sur plusieurs serveurs pour garantir une plus grande disponibilité des applications...